1395 dnl CF_CHECK_WCWIDTH_GRAPHICS version: 2 updated: 2021/01/02 17:09:14
1396 dnl -------------------------
1397 dnl Most "modern" terminal emulators are based to some degree on VT100, and
1398 dnl should support line-drawing. Even with Unicode. There is a problem.
1400 dnl While most of the VT100 graphics characters were incorporated into Unicode,
1401 dnl all of those were combined into a page of useful graphics characters.
1403 dnl So far, so good.
1405 dnl However, while they are useful, there are other considerations. CJK
1406 dnl is (because of poor device resolution) often rendered as double-width
1407 dnl characters. So... for these generally-useful characters, what should
1408 dnl be the width (to make them consistent with adjacent characters)?
1410 dnl The obvious choice would have been to make this locale-dependent, and use
1411 dnl wcwidth() to tell applications what the actual width is. That was too
1412 dnl obvious. Instead, we have a slew of "ambiguous-width" characters.
1414 dnl http://www.unicode.org/reports/tr11/tr11-29.html
1415 dnl http://www.cl.cam.ac.uk/~mgk25/ucs/scw-proposal.html
1417 dnl The EastAsianWidth-6.2.0.txt file from the Unicode organization lists
1418 dnl more than 22,000 characters, with 1281 of those as ambiguous-width. For
1419 dnl instance, it lists half (44/96) of the Latin-1 characters as
1420 dnl ambiguous-width. Also, all of the box-characters at 0x2500 are ambiguous.
1422 dnl What this means for the implementor is that on some systems wcwidth() can
1423 dnl give bad advice. On Solaris, some of the ambiguous widths are returned as
1424 dnl 1 (the Latin-1 characters), while others are returned as 2 (line-drawing
1425 dnl characters). These do not necessarily match the behavior of the terminal
1426 dnl emulator. xterm, for instance, does an optional startup check to find if
1427 dnl this problem (or similar) exists with the system's locale tables, rejecting
1428 dnl them if they are too unreliable.

1606 dnl CF_CONST_X_STRING version: 6 updated: 2021/01/01 13:31:04
1607 dnl -----------------
1608 dnl The X11R4-X11R6 Xt specification uses an ambiguous String type for most
1609 dnl character-strings.
1611 dnl It is ambiguous because the specification accommodated the pre-ANSI
1612 dnl compilers bundled by more than one vendor in lieu of providing a standard C
1613 dnl compiler other than by costly add-ons. Because of this, the specification
1614 dnl did not take into account the use of const for telling the compiler that
1615 dnl string literals would be in readonly memory.
1617 dnl As a workaround, one could (starting with X11R5) define XTSTRINGDEFINES, to
1618 dnl let the compiler decide how to represent Xt's strings which were #define'd.
1619 dnl That does not solve the problem of using the block of Xt's strings which
1620 dnl are compiled into the library (and is less efficient than one might want).
1622 dnl Xt specification 7 introduces the _CONST_X_STRING symbol which is used both
1623 dnl when compiling the library and compiling using the library, to tell the
1624 dnl compiler that String is const.
